Zoloft and Nail dystrophy - a phase IV clinical study of FDA data
Summary:
Nail dystrophy is reported as a side effect among people who take Zoloft (sertraline hydrochloride), especially for people who are female, 60+ old, also take Aredia, and have Muscle spasms.
The phase IV clinical study analyzes which people have Nail dystrophy when taking Zoloft. It is created by eHealthMe based on reports of 128,159 people who have side effects when taking Zoloft from the FDA, and is updated regularly.

128,159 people reported to have side effects when taking Zoloft.
Among them, 13 people (0.01%) have Nail dystrophy.

Among these 13 people:
What is the gender of people who have Nail dystrophy when taking Zoloft? *
- female: 75 %
- male: 25 %

How the study uses the data?
The study uses data from the FDA. It is based on sertraline hydrochloride (the active ingredients of Zoloft) and Zoloft (the brand name). Other drugs that have the same active ingredients (e.g. generic drugs) are not considered. Dosage of drugs is not considered in the study.
